    Abstract: A table for use in an autopsy, necropsy, pathology or dissection procedure, wherein the table comprises a base and a carrier rotatably connected to the base. The table also comprises a first tray arranged within the carrier and a second tray arranged within the carrier. The second tray is parallel to the first tray when in a first position and the second tray and the first tray having a predetermined sized gap arranged therebetween when the carrier is in a first position. The rotating autopsy table may allow for a single user of the table to perform an autopsy procedure on the front of a cadaver or body and then rotate the table on their own, such that the autopsy procedure may be continued on the back of the body without help from other equipment or other people to flip or turn the body over.

    Abstract: A couch top includes a top, a base, a universal joint coupling the top and the base, and actuators mounted on the base to pitch and roll the top. Feedback devices may be fitted on the rotating ends of the universal joint to provide feedback for a control loop. Each actuator has an actuated end that translates vertically to lift or lower the top. The vertical movement may be derived from a carriage riding in place on a translating inclined plane. When the actuated ends move in the same direction, they pitch the top. When the actuated ends move in the opposite directions, they roll the top. Feedback devices may be fitted on motors in the actuators to provide feedback for the control loop.
